OBITUARY
Anna Marie Fund was born March 26, 1918 at Traer, Iowa the daughter of Fred and Anna (Madera) Novotny. Annie attended school at Traer and graduated from Traer High School in the Class of 1936. She continued her education at Iowa State Teachers College in Cedar Falls. She then taught country school at Crystal No. 5 until 1939.
On October 2, 1939 she was united in marriage to Joseph A. Rund and they made their home farming near Toledo before moving to a farm northwest of Traer where they made their home for 33 years.
Annie was also employed as a food service supervisor at Schoitz Hospital in Waterloo for ten years.
Joe and Annie retired to their home at 706 Crestview Drive in 1974 and spent winter months in Scottsdale, Arizona. Joe and Annie enjoyed entertaining family and friends.
After Joe's death on February 14, 1991 she continued to make her home in Traer. Annie's death came in Traer on Tuesday, ,July 23, 1996 at the age of 78 years.
She was preceded in death by her parents, husband, three sisters; Matilda Kolpek, Christinie Wobeter and Phyllis Zmolek.
She is survived by one son Gene and his wife Bev Rund of Traer and one daughter Jan (Mrs. Terry) Rogers of Lake Tahoe, NV, five grandchildren; Brad, Mark, Rita, Christine and Logan and two great grandchildren, Brittany and Brooke.
